#346586 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#346586 is composed of 20.4% red, 39.6%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 36.5%. #346586 color hex could be obtained by blending #68caff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#346586 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#346586 has RGB values of R:52, G:101,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3433862.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030507 is the darkest color, while #f8fafc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585e62 is the less saturated color, while #026fb8 is the most saturated one.
